• Home
  • Raw
  • Download

Lines Matching refs:VoidPtrTy

38   llvm::PointerType *CharPtrTy, *VoidPtrTy, *VoidPtrPtrTy;  member in __anoncc61ed400111::CGNVCUDARuntime
182 VoidPtrTy = cast<llvm::PointerType>(Types.ConvertType(Ctx.VoidPtrTy)); in CGNVCUDARuntime()
183 VoidPtrPtrTy = VoidPtrTy->getPointerTo(); in CGNVCUDARuntime()
188 llvm::Type *Params[] = {VoidPtrTy, SizeTy, SizeTy}; in getSetupArgumentFn()
211 return llvm::FunctionType::get(VoidTy, VoidPtrTy, false); in getCallbackFnTy()
217 llvm::Type *Params[] = {RegisterGlobalsFnTy->getPointerTo(), VoidPtrTy, in getRegisterLinkedBinaryFnTy()
218 VoidPtrTy, CallbackFnTy->getPointerTo()}; in getRegisterLinkedBinaryFnTy()
261 VoidPtrTy, CharUnits::fromQuantity(16), "kernel_args", in emitDeviceStubBodyNew()
266 llvm::Value *VoidVarPtr = CGF.Builder.CreatePointerCast(VarPtr, VoidPtrTy); in emitDeviceStubBodyNew()
306 CGF.CreateTempAlloca(VoidPtrTy, CGM.getPointerAlign(), "stream"); in emitDeviceStubBodyNew()
321 llvm::Value *Kernel = CGF.Builder.CreatePointerCast(CGF.CurFn, VoidPtrTy); in emitDeviceStubBodyNew()
361 VoidPtrTy), in emitDeviceStubBodyLegacy()
414 VoidPtrTy, VoidPtrTy, VoidPtrTy, VoidPtrTy, IntTy->getPointerTo()}; in makeRegisterGlobalsFn()
426 llvm::Constant *NullPtr = llvm::ConstantPointerNull::get(VoidPtrTy); in makeRegisterGlobalsFn()
429 Builder.CreateBitCast(I.Kernel, VoidPtrTy), in makeRegisterGlobalsFn()
459 VoidTy, {VoidPtrPtrTy, VoidPtrTy, CharPtrTy, CharPtrTy, IntTy, IntTy}, in makeRegisterGlobalsFn()
467 {VoidPtrPtrTy, VoidPtrTy, CharPtrTy, CharPtrTy, IntTy, IntTy, IntTy}, in makeRegisterGlobalsFn()
479 Builder.CreateBitCast(Var, VoidPtrTy), in makeRegisterGlobalsFn()
492 {&GpuBinaryHandlePtr, Builder.CreateBitCast(Var, VoidPtrTy), VarName, in makeRegisterGlobalsFn()
499 {&GpuBinaryHandlePtr, Builder.CreateBitCast(Var, VoidPtrTy), VarName, in makeRegisterGlobalsFn()
550 llvm::FunctionType::get(VoidPtrPtrTy, VoidPtrTy, false), in makeModuleCtorFunction()
554 llvm::StructType::get(IntTy, IntTy, VoidPtrTy, VoidPtrTy); in makeModuleCtorFunction()
573 llvm::FunctionType::get(VoidTy, VoidPtrTy, false), in makeModuleCtorFunction()
650 Values.add(llvm::ConstantPointerNull::get(VoidPtrTy)); in makeModuleCtorFunction()
696 CtorBuilder.CreateBitCast(FatbinWrapper, VoidPtrTy)); in makeModuleCtorFunction()
714 CtorBuilder.CreateBitCast(FatbinWrapper, VoidPtrTy)); in makeModuleCtorFunction()
756 CtorBuilder.CreateBitCast(FatbinWrapper, VoidPtrTy), in makeModuleCtorFunction()
809 llvm::FunctionType::get(VoidTy, VoidPtrTy, false), in makeModuleDtorFunction()